Abstract

The utility model provides a cabinet is accomodate to intelligent regulation, include: an intelligent control unit arranged in the cabinet body is electrically connected with the temperature and humidity adjusting device and the temperature and humidity sensor; the temperature and humidity adjusting device is attached to one side surface of the interior of the cabinet body; the temperature and humidity adjusting device comprises an air filter screen, a grid, a compression dehumidifying mechanism and a corresponding circuit module, wherein the compression dehumidifying mechanism and the corresponding circuit module are arranged in the temperature and humidity adjusting device; the moisture exhaust port is arranged at the position below the air inlet and is connected to the outside of the cabinet body through a pipe fitting. Humidity is automatically adjusted through a temperature and humidity adjusting device and a humidity sensing device in the storage cabinet, so that articles in the storage cabinet are stored in an ideal humidity environment, the articles can be stored for a long time, and deterioration or mildew caused by humidity problems can be avoided.

Description

Cabinet is accomodate in intelligent regulation
Technical Field
The utility model relates to an intelligence house technical field especially relates to a cabinet is accomodate in intelligent regulation.
Background
In the life at home, often all can use the locker, it can hang in wardrobe or room, when make full use of space, has certain decorative effect. The daily use of articles has a classification function, and the clothes storage cabinet is a product which is used for storing clothes in most cases.
The storage cabinet in the existing market is various, and only can meet the requirements of storing articles in life.
However, some articles need to be stored for a long time and need to be stored in an environment with proper humidity, and a common storage cabinet can only store articles, clothes and the like, so that the humidity and the temperature of the storage cabinet cannot be adjusted.

Detailed Description
In order to make the above objects, features and advantages of the present invention more comprehensible, the present invention is described in detail with reference to the accompanying drawings and the detailed description.
One of the core ideas of the utility model is that the temperature and humidity adjusting device is skillfully arranged in the storage cabinet, and the intelligent control module controls the temperature and humidity adjusting device to adjust the temperature and the humidity by combining the temperature and humidity information detected by the humidity sensing device; and the air blowing device at a proper position is further adjusted to enable the air in the cabinet body to form airflow circulation and control the temperature of the airflow, so that the relative humidity and the temperature of each position in the space of the cabinet body are more balanced, and in addition, the ultraviolet sterilization can be carried out on the articles contained in the cabinet.
Referring to fig. 1-3, the embodiment of the utility model discloses cabinet is accomodate in intelligent regulation specifically can include: the intelligent control unit 3 arranged inside the cabinet body 1 is respectively and electrically connected with the temperature and humidity adjusting device 2 and the temperature and humidity sensor 4; the temperature and humidity adjusting device 2 is attached to one side surface of the interior of the cabinet body 1; the temperature and humidity adjusting device 2 includes: the cabinet comprises an air filter screen, a grid, a dehumidifying part, a refrigerating part and a corresponding circuit module which are arranged in the temperature and humidity adjusting device 2, an air outlet 23 arranged at the upper end of the temperature and humidity adjusting device 2, an air inlet 21 arranged at the side surface of the temperature and humidity adjusting device 1 and a moisture exhaust port, so that not only can the humidity in the cabinet body 1 be adjusted, but also the temperature in the cabinet body can be intelligently adjusted according to the temperature information detected by the temperature and humidity sensor 4; the moisture exhaust port is arranged at a position below the air inlet 21 and is connected to the outside of the cabinet body 1 through a pipe fitting; the air filter screen is arranged at the inner side of the air inlet 21 in a telescopic manner and used for filtering impurities with larger particle sizes in the air, the air filter screen to be cleaned can be taken out through the filter screen opening 22 or the cleaned filter screen is inserted into the temperature and humidity adjusting device 2 through the filter screen opening 22, and the air filter screen can be cleaned or replaced conveniently; the grid mesh is arranged on the inner side of the air outlet 23 and used for preventing foreign matters from falling into the air outlet after the air outlet is opened; the circuit of the device and the unit inside the cabinet body 1 is connected, as shown in fig. 4, the intelligent control unit 3 and the temperature and humidity adjusting device 2 are electrically connected with an external power supply through the power taking port 15.
In another embodiment, a blowing device 12 is arranged at the top end of the interior of the cabinet body 1; the blowing device 12 is electrically connected to the intelligent control unit 3 through an electric wire arranged in an interlayer of the cabinet body 1, and is used for intelligently controlling the start and stop of the blowing device 12, so that the air flow in the space of the cabinet body 1 is enhanced, and the air humidity in the cabinet body is more uniform; the blowing device 12 includes: a first fan and a heating unit disposed in the fan net; the heating unit is arranged in front of the fan blade of the first fan, air in the cabinet can be heated while air flow in the cabinet is enhanced, when the temperature in the cabinet body 1 is lower than a range value set through the intelligent control unit 3, the first fan and the heating unit are automatically started, and when heating is not needed, the first fan can be controlled to be started only, so that the temperature and the humidity of the air in the cabinet body 1 are more uniform.
In another embodiment, an ultraviolet germicidal lamp 14 is further arranged inside the cabinet body 1; the uv germicidal lamp 14 is electrically connected to the intelligent control unit 3, and can sterilize the articles inside the cabinet 1 by setting the on-time and the on-period, for example, setting the uv germicidal lamp to be turned on every day for half an hour to sterilize inside the cabinet.
In another embodiment, the temperature and humidity adjusting device 2 further includes a water storage tank 24 detachably disposed at a lower end of one side of the temperature and humidity adjusting device 2; a water inlet of the water storage tank 24 is connected with a water outlet of the temperature and humidity adjusting device 2 in a matching manner; a water level sensor 25 is arranged in the water storage tank 24; the water level sensor 24 with the internal circuit electric connection of temperature and humidity control device 2 for when the inconvenient drainage pipe who is connected to the cabinet body 1 outside at temperature and humidity control device, can use storage water tank 24 to carry out the water storage, directly take out empty storage water tank 24 when storing up full, pack into temperature and humidity control device 2's inside with storage water tank 24 after empty again, when the water in storage water tank 24 is full, water level sensor 25 transmits the signal to the inside control circuit of temperature and humidity control device 2, control circuit stops temperature and humidity control device 2's work, prevent to overflow storage water tank 24 after water is full.
In another embodiment, the temperature and humidity sensor 4 is a remote sensing temperature and humidity sensor 4; the signal output end of the temperature and humidity sensor 4 is wirelessly connected to the signal receiving end of the intelligent control unit 3, wherein the Wireless connection at least comprises one or more of a WIFI (Wireless Fidelity) connection, a bluetooth connection and an infrared connection, the intelligent control unit 3 adjusts and controls the temperature and humidity adjusting device 2 to work according to the received humidity information, for example, when the temperature and humidity sensor 4 senses that the relative humidity is higher than 60%, the temperature and humidity sensor can be connected to the intelligent control unit 3 through infrared or WIFI or bluetooth for starting the temperature and humidity adjusting device 2 to perform dehumidifying work, and when the relative humidity is detected to be lower than 40%, the temperature and humidity sensor stops working.
In another embodiment, at least 1 temperature and humidity sensor is arranged; temperature and humidity sensor 4 sets up the corner position of the upper end in the cabinet body 1, avoids because the air outlet air current of first fan and temperature and humidity sensor directly blows on it, and humidity value and the temperature value that lead to detecting are inaccurate.
In another embodiment, a communication sub-module is arranged inside the intelligent control unit 3; the communication sub-module at least comprises one or more of WIFI, Bluetooth, infrared and mobile networks. The humidity information state is obtained through communication between the communication submodule and the terminal (such as a mobile phone APP), and the terminal (such as a mobile phone or a tablet computer) can be used for sending an instruction to the intelligent control unit 3 through a remote communication function to inquire the working state and/or remotely control the temperature and humidity adjusting device 2 to work or stop working.
In another embodiment, the cabinet body 1 is further provided with a cabinet door 11 connected with the cabinet body by using a hinge; a magnetic adsorption piece is arranged at the buckling position of the cabinet door 11 and the cabinet body 1, so that the cabinet door 11 can be closed well, and the situation that the cabinet door 11 is not closed tightly and a larger gap is formed is prevented; still be equipped with cabinet door switch sensor 13 on the cabinet body 1, cabinet door switch sensor 13 electric connection to intelligent control unit 3, when cabinet door switch sensor 13 detected that cabinet door 11 opens, intelligent control unit 3 can not open the ultraviolet germicidal lamp 14 of the internal portion of cabinet to and stop temperature and humidity control device 2 work, prevent when not closing cabinet door 11 or forgetting to close cabinet door 11, the device of the internal portion of cabinet was handled operating condition always.
In another embodiment, the ultraviolet germicidal lamp 14 is a deep ultraviolet germicidal LED (Light Emitting Diode) lamp, which has the advantages of small volume, power saving, environmental protection, long service life, and the like.
